Tour Details
The Trike Tour of Naples includes the use of a Trikke, a guided tour by a knowledgeable guide, and all gratuities and taxes.
The tour can accommodate up to 25 travelers, though it’s not wheelchair accessible and isn’t recommended for pregnant individuals or those with heart problems or serious medical conditions.
Some key details:
- Not wheelchair accessible
- Service animals allowed
- Not recommended for pregnant travelers
- No heart problems or serious medical conditions
The tour starts and ends at the meeting point in Tin City Shops, with free parking available.
Booking confirmation is provided upon reservation, and there’s a free cancellation policy up to 24 hours before the experience.
Meeting and Pickup
The Trike Tour of Naples begins at the meeting point located inside the Tin City Shops, next to Pinchers Crab Shack and an ice cream store, at 1200 5th Ave S, Naples, FL 34102.
Free parking is available at the Tin City Shops. The activity concludes back at the meeting point.
Travelers should arrive at the meeting point on time, as the tour departs promptly. Participants can easily find the meeting point, which is conveniently situated within the lively Tin City Shops.
After the tour, travelers can explore the nearby shops and restaurants at their leisure.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I Bring My Own Trike/Scooter on the Tour?
Unfortunately, you can’t bring your own trike or scooter on the Trike Tour of Naples. The tour provides the trikes, and they don’t allow participants to use their own personal vehicles during the experience.
Is the Tour Route the Same Every Time?
The tour route may vary each time to provide a unique experience for participants. The guides likely adjust the route based on factors like traffic, construction, or to highlight different attractions in the Naples area.
Do I Need to Have Any Prior Experience Operating a Trike?
No prior experience is required to operate the trikes on the tour. The tour guides provide a brief orientation and safety instructions before the tour starts, so even first-time riders can feel comfortable and enjoy the experience.
